Balluff releases brochure supporting error proofing, a production quality improvement technique being adopted by leading manufacturers.

Balluff has released a brochure in support of error proofing, a production quality improvement technique that is being adopted by leading manufacturing companies.

Error proofing consists of sensor-driven quality checks custom designed for each manufacturing process to help prevent a part being made incorrectly.

Using this process, sensors no longer merely report that an assembly step is complete or that a production pallet is in a certain location.

Now they verify that a part is being manufactured correctly at each stage of the process and prevent the process from continuing if it is not.

Using error proofing, a finished product is automatically within specification.

Error proofing can also protect expensive production equipment, automatically identify production subassemblies, and protect operators from dangerous conditions on the line.

A good error proofing programme can increase productivity, increase product quality and decrease costs and scrap.
